Deism
Deism ( DEE-iz-əm or DAY-iz-əm; derived from the Latin term deus, meaning "god") is the belief, based solely upon logic and observation while rejecting any supernatural speculation, that a Supreme Being or God created the universe. As a philosophical position and rationalistic theology that rejects prophecies, revelations, and religious texts as legitimate or reliable sources of divine knowledge, Deism instead asserts that empirical reason and observation of the natural world are exclusively logical, reliable, and sufficient to determine the existence of a creator God.
